Description
OCTAGONAL LATIN CROSS AND SHAFT, ON SQUARE PLINTH AND TWO STEPPED BASE. CARVED WREATH ON FRONT FACE. An additional plaque was added in 2014 for extra WW1 names
Inscription
FRONT: TO THE GLORY OF GOD/ AND IN HONOURED MEMORY/ OF THE MEN OF SUTTON IN CRAVEN/ WHO MADE THE SUPREME SACRIFICE/ FOR GOD, KING AND COUNTRY/ IN THE GREAT WAR/ 1914 - 1919/ THEIR NAMES LIVETH FOR EVERMORE/ ALSO TO THE MEN OF THIS PARISH WHO/ FELL IN THE SECOND WORLD WAR 1939 - 1945/ (NAMES) SIDES AND REAR: (WW1 NAMES) Extra WW1 Plaque- THE FOLLOWING NAMES WERE ADDED ON 4TH AUGUST 2014/ON THE CENTENARY OF THE GREAT WAR 1914-1918/[11 names]
